Effects of mutation position on frequency of marker rescue by homologous recombination.
Molecular and cellular biology - 1 Aug 1992
Jiang L, Connor A, Shulman M J
Abstract excerpt
Homologous recombination between transferred and chromosomal DNA can be used for mapping mutations by marker rescue, i.e., by identifying which segment of wild-type DNA can recombine with the mutant chromosomal gene and restore normal function. In order to define how much the fragments should overlap each other for reliable mapping, we have measured how the frequency of marker rescue is affected by the position...
